11% Failure Rate: Notes From A VC Who Doesn't Fit The Mold

Sharon Vosmek, a San Francisco-based VC, makes her editorial debut with a Forbes column in which she will explore what it takes to start a company, raise capital, and scale.

Vosmek begins by discussing the 11% failure rate mentioned in the title, which refers to the percentage of her investments that have not met expectations. She emphasizes that this rate is significantly lower than the industry average, which often hovers around 20-30%. Vosmek attributes her success to her unconventional approach to investing, which prioritizes diversity, inclusion, and a deep understanding of the markets she invests in.
One of the key themes of the article is the importance of diversity in the VC industry. Vosmek argues that the lack of diversity among investors leads to a lack of diversity in the startups that receive funding. She points out that women and people of color are significantly underrepresented in the VC world, which in turn affects the types of companies that get funded. Vosmek believes that increasing diversity among investors will lead to a more diverse and innovative startup ecosystem.
Vosmek shares her personal story of breaking into the VC industry, which was not an easy feat. As a woman of color, she faced numerous barriers and biases. However, she persevered and built a successful career by focusing on her strengths and leveraging her unique perspective. She emphasizes the importance of resilience and determination in the face of adversity.
The article also delves into Vosmek's investment philosophy. She believes in taking a hands-on approach to investing, working closely with the founders of the companies she invests in. Vosmek sees herself as a partner and mentor to these founders, providing guidance and support as they navigate the challenges of building a startup. She also emphasizes the importance of understanding the market and the problem that the startup is trying to solve. Vosmek believes that a deep understanding of the market is crucial for making successful investments.
Vosmek also discusses the importance of due diligence in the investment process. She believes that thorough due diligence is essential for identifying the most promising startups and avoiding potential pitfalls. Vosmek shares some of the key factors she looks for when evaluating a potential investment, including the strength of the founding team, the size of the market opportunity, and the company's competitive advantage.
Throughout the article, Vosmek emphasizes the importance of learning from failure. She believes that failure is an inevitable part of the VC process and that the key is to learn from these failures and use them to improve future investments. Vosmek shares some of the lessons she has learned from her own failures, including the importance of being patient and the need to be willing to pivot when necessary.
The article also touches on the current state of the VC industry and the challenges it faces. Vosmek believes that the industry is at a crossroads and that there is a need for change. She argues that the traditional VC model, which focuses on high-risk, high-reward investments, is no longer sustainable. Vosmek believes that the industry needs to shift towards a more sustainable and inclusive model that prioritizes long-term value creation over short-term gains.
Vosmek also discusses the role of technology in the VC industry. She believes that technology has the potential to revolutionize the way that VC firms operate, making the process more efficient and accessible. Vosmek shares some of the ways that she has leveraged technology in her own firm, including the use of data analytics to identify promising startups and the use of online platforms to connect with founders.
Throughout the article, Vosmek emphasizes the importance of giving back to the community. She believes that successful investors have a responsibility to mentor and support the next generation of entrepreneurs. Vosmek shares some of the ways that she gives back, including mentoring young founders and investing in startups that are working to solve social and environmental problems.
In conclusion, "11% Failure Rate: Notes From A VC Who Doesn't Fit The Mold" provides a compelling and insightful look into the world of venture capital through the eyes of an unconventional investor. Sharon Vosmek's unique perspective and experiences offer valuable lessons for anyone interested in the VC industry. The article highlights the importance of diversity, the need for a more sustainable and inclusive investment model, and the power of resilience and determination in the face of adversity. Vosmek's story is an inspiration to anyone looking to break into the VC world and make a difference.
